Money-Saving Tips for Tallinn
Walk through the medieval Old Town — a UNESCO World Heritage Site, free to explore
Eat at Rataskaevu 16 or local pubs for $5-8 meals
Visit Telliskivi Creative City for free street art and markets
Take the tram for $1.10 per ride or get a day pass for $3.50
View the city from Toompea Hill observation platforms for free

What is the cheapest time to visit Tallinn?
Shoulder season (April, October) typically offers lower flight prices — around $464 vs $569 during peak season. Budget travellers can spend as little as $28/day on the ground.
